Q: Is 179,127 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 179,127 is a composite number.

Why is 179,127 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 179,127 can be evenly divided by 1 3 9 13 39 117 1,531 4,593 13,779 19,903 59,709 and 179,127, with no remainder.

Since 179,127 cannot be divided by just 1 and 179,127, it is a composite number.
